The knowledge of the Statute of Limitations

Asbestos sufferers have a short period of time to file a lawsuit or trust fund claim. It is imperative that a victim locate an attorney who is knowledgeable about the statutes of limitations. This will make sure that the patient is able to pursue their case without being hampered by the absence of deadlines.

For most personal injury cases, the statute of limitations begins when an victim is injured. However in cases involving asbestos law exposure, there is a special rule known as the discovery rule. The statute of limitations begins when the asbestos disease is diagnosed, but not when the individual first was exposed to it. This is due to the fact that mesothelioma, and other asbestos-related diseases, often have a lengthy latency period.

The discovery rule is important for victims because it allows them to start a mesothelioma suit against the companies who wrongly exposed them to asbestos. A mesothelioma case is a personal injury claim and involves monetary compensation for damages, including loss of income, medical expenses and pain and suffering. A wrongful death suit can be filed by the family of a victim who died from mesothelioma or a different asbestos-related disease. In the case of wrongful death the jury awards victims and their families compensation for funeral expenses and loss of companionship. Asbestos victims might also be able to file a workers compensation claim against their employer to receive financial aid. They may also be eligible for VA benefits if they were in the military. Workers compensation claims are likely to be settled out of court whereas mesothelioma claims are often investigated.
